What Are THC Drinks and How Do They Work?

If you’re new to the category, the short answer to “what are THC drinks” is this: They’re cannabis-infused beverages, shots, dissolvable mixes, and syrups designed to be consumed orally rather than smoked or vaped.

Most THC drink brands rely on nano-emulsion technology to shorten onset compared to traditional edibles. How long for THC drinks to work depends on the product and your body, but many drinks are formulated to arrive in about 15 to 30 minutes, compared to the 60 to 90 minutes typical for standard edibles.

The answer for how to drink THC drinks is straightforward, but it does depend on the type of product you’re buying. For some, you simply pour and sip. Others need to be mixed into a base like sparkling water, or shaken with ice and a citrus twist to get their full flavor.
